Thursday, November 27, 2008. The Tarpan, Equus ferus ferus, was the Eurasian wild horse. The last specimen of this species died in captivity in Ukraine. In 1876. The name Tarpan is from a Turkic language. Name for the horse. Several attempts have been made to re-create the Tarpan, beginning in the 1930s. The breeds that resulted included the Heck horse. Thursday, November 27, 2008. The dam is located at 35°31′15″N 91°59′36″W / 35.52083, -91.99333. North of Little Rock. It was dedicated in October, 1963 by President John F. Kennedy. Just one month before his assassination. This event marks the only time a sitting president has visited Cleburne County. Construction of the dam began in March 1959 and was completed in December 1962. The lake serves the Heber Springs. After completion, the lake was dedicated on October 3, 1963 by John F. Kennedy.
